(February 17th, 2013, 02:21)plako Wrote: I presume we need 4th mine near Bitter in 2T to finish the last missionary on time? There are 2 cottaging workers SW from HN that could do that (I'll send turn report soon so you can see this better), if needed.

Bitter is pulling 13 hpt and will be putting 26 hammers into a missionary on T120. So to finish that on T121, we need another hammer. Either from a mine, or by cottaging the plains tile S of Bitter and working that. The plains cottage might be a nice tile to work during the GA, but perhaps the mine is even better. Looks like Bitter will be stuck at size 7 for a while, so it may as well maximize its production and spit out missionaries and other units for a while. (We should finish the spear in the queue before it decays too much.)

If we need to do some busywork while waiting for CS we could build a shorter road between HN and the capital, to save a turn of transit on any great people that are moving to settle.

Micro notes:
- WIFOM should grow to 8 next turn. It looks like it will grow unhappy, but it won't, because it will pass Bitter in size and get the representation happiness.
- Bitter can eke its way to size 8 at +2f, +2f, +3f, +3f in the 4 next turns, by which time its whip anger will have expired. When it hits size 8 it will also reclaim the +3 happy from representation, but WIFOM's whip anger has also expired then so it's not a problem.
- I suggest farming all three riverside tiles east of EB. We can always cottage them later if we decide to, but for now the city really needs food, as HN will be hogging both the wheat and the spices.
- Do we bulb philosophy next turn? We're probably not in a race so I guess we can hold off until we've spread hinduism where we need it. Good that we didn't miss the dice roll in OTR, btw.
